He was the son of W.J. and Maria Smith Robb of Davidson County. during the civil War, he served the Confederate army as a steward. He later married Maggie S. Dwyer, Oct. 19,1880, and later settled in mountainous area along Maury-Giles County line, serving the medical needs of the neighborhood and delivered many babies including his own grandchildren.
Their children were: Mamie, William Joseph, John Hugh, Harry Merton, Maggie, Charles S. and Roberta V.
